Former Maritzburg coach joins Pirates

Fadlu David’s has joined Orlando Pirates technical team after leaving Maritzburg United, the Soweto giants confirmed on their website on Tuesday morning.


The 37-year old has filled the vacancy of the Bucs technical team which was left Benson Mhlongo who joined National Forst Divaion side TS Sporting last year.

Pirates chairman Irvin Khoza welcomes Davids at the club and he will be working alongside head coach Micho Sredojevic and assistant Rhulani Mokoena.

“I would like to take this opportunity to welcome Mr Davids to Orlando Pirates,” said the Bucs chairman.

“What was gratifying when I introduced the coach to the technical team there was an instant cordiality and rapport between them.”

“It is also quite exciting to have two emerging talents in Rhulani and Fadlu complementing each other.”
